python种类以及执行过程

JPython: 代码——>——>字节码——>——>机器码——>CPU

Cpython:代码——>——>字节码——>——>机器码——>CPU

ironPyth:代码——>——>字节码——>——>机器码——>CPU

pypy:        代码——>——>机器码——>CPU

如以上所示:

python分为JPython(Javapython)、Cpython、ironPyth(C#python)、pypy,前三种均需通过相应虚拟机将字节码转化成机器码,再交给CPU进行执行,pypy省略了字节码转换成机器码的过程,代码通过解释器直接可生成机器码,执行效率明显提升,但应用尚不广泛

 

猜你喜欢

转载自www.cnblogs.com/zmhx/p/10057516.html
今日推荐